Abstract (EN)

The 6-Methoxyquinoline molecule given with the molecular formula C10H9NO in this study is in the Cs point group. The FT-infrared and FT-Raman spectra of the free molecule were recorded, and the vibrational frequencies and modes of this molecule were determined. Vibrational frequencies were marked. Theoretical frequency values, geometric parameters, HOMO-LUMO analysis, electrostatic surface map, thermochemical properties, Fukui functions, nonlinear optical properties and charge analyzes were obtained with the help of Gaussian 09 computer program. The obtained values were compared with the experimental results.
